Market Overview
Global Game Engines Market has experienced
tremendous growth in recent years and is poised to continue its strong expansion.
The Game Engines Market reached a value of USD 2.98 billion in 2022 and is
projected to maintain a compound annual growth rate of 13.5% through 2028. The

Growing Indie Game Development
The rise of independent game developers, often
referred to as "indie" developers, is a significant driving force in
the Global Game Engines Market. Indie game studios and individual developers
have become a vibrant and influential segment of the gaming industry, thanks in
large part to the accessibility and affordability of modern game engines.
Game engines empower indie developers by offering
user-friendly development environments and robust toolsets. These engines
significantly reduce the barriers to entry into the game development industry,
enabling smaller studios and solo developers to create and publish games with
relatively limited resources.
In addition to accessibility, many game engines
offer licensing models that cater specifically to indie developers. These models
often include revenue-sharing agreements or affordable subscription plans,
making it economically feasible for indies to access advanced engine features.
The success stories of indie games like
"Minecraft," "Undertale," and "Hollow Knight"
demonstrate the potential for indie developers to create critically acclaimed
and commercially successful titles. This success, in turn, fuels the demand for
game engines that cater to the unique needs and creative visions of indie
developers.
As indie game development continues to thrive, the
Global Game Engines Market benefits from the increasing adoption of engines by
a diverse and innovative community of developers. The growth of indie game
development not only expands the user base of game engines but also fosters a
culture of experimentation and creativity that drives innovation in the gaming
industry as a whole.

Monetization Pressures and Gamer Backlash
Another significant challenge in the Game Engines
Market is the delicate balance between monetization strategies and player
satisfaction. Developers rely on various monetization models, including
free-to-play (F2P) with in-app purchases, downloadable content (DLC),
microtransactions, and subscription services, to generate revenue from their
games.
However, the implementation of these models can
lead to player backlash if not executed thoughtfully. Gamers often express
frustration over pay-to-win mechanics, loot boxes, and other forms of
aggressive monetization that can disrupt gameplay and create an unfair
advantage for players willing to spend more money.
Regulatory scrutiny of certain monetization
practices, particularly with respect to gambling-related mechanics in games,
adds an additional layer of complexity and risk for game developers. Striking a
balance between generating revenue and maintaining a positive player experience
is a constant challenge, and missteps can result in reputational damage and
regulatory penalties.
Furthermore, the gaming community's heightened
awareness of these issues has led to increased scrutiny and vocal criticism of
game developers and publishers. Negative publicity and backlash can have a
significant impact on a game's success and can erode player trust.

Key Market Trends
Real-Time Ray Tracing Technology
Real-time ray tracing is a revolutionary rendering
technology that has taken the gaming industry by storm. It simulates the
behavior of light in virtual environments, enabling game developers to create
stunningly realistic graphics and visuals. This trend has gained substantial
momentum as major game engines have integrated real-time ray tracing
capabilities.
Real-time ray tracing enhances the gaming
experience by providing lifelike lighting, shadows, reflections, and
refractions. It allows for the creation of environments that react dynamically
to light sources and materials, resulting in unprecedented visual fidelity and
immersion.
This trend is driven by the availability of
high-performance graphics hardware, such as NVIDIA's RTX series GPUs and AMD's
RDNA2 architecture, which are specifically designed to accelerate ray tracing.
Game developers are harnessing this hardware to deliver breathtaking graphics
in titles like "Cyberpunk 2077" and "Control."
Additionally, real-time ray tracing has
applications beyond traditional gaming. It is increasingly being used in
architectural visualization, film production, and automotive design, expanding
the market for game engines equipped with this technology.

Integ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I)
Artificial intelligence (AI) integration is a
significant trend in the Global Game Engines Market. Game engines are
increasingly incorporating AI-driven features and capabilities to enhance
gameplay, storytelling, and overall player experiences.
AI is being used to create more dynamic and
responsive in-game characters and enemies. These AI-driven entities can adapt
to player actions, making games feel more challenging and immersive.
Additionally, AI can be utilized to create procedurally generated content,
leading to more expansive and replayable game worlds.
In storytelling, AI-powered dialogue systems and
narrative generation tools are becoming prevalent. These systems allow for
branching storylines, personalized character interactions, and dynamic
storytelling that responds to player choices. Games like "Detroit: Become
Human" showcase the potential of AI-driven narratives.
AI also plays a crucial role in improving game
optimization and performance. AI-driven algorithms can dynamically adjust
graphics settings and resource allocation based on a player's hardware,
ensuring a smoother gaming experience and maximizing visual quality.
Furthermore, AI-driven analytics and player
behavior analysis are helping game developers understand player preferences,
identify trends, and optimize game design and monetization strategies. This
data-driven approach enhances the overall player experience and the financial
success of games.
As AI continues to advance, game engines that
embrace and integrate AI technologies are at the forefront of innovation,
enabling developers to create more engaging, responsive, and data-informed
gaming experiences. This trend is set to further shape the future of the Game
Engines Market.
